What is Self-Leveling Concrete?

Self-leveling concrete refers to a specially formulated concrete mix designed to effortlessly flow and fill low spots while leveling out uneven surfaces. In contrast to standard concrete, which typically requires considerable manual labor to achieve a level finish, self-leveling concrete autonomously settles into place. This versatile solution is prevalent in various contexts, including residential homes, commercial venues, and industrial environments. Often, it serves as a foundational layer for various floor coverings such as tiles, carpet, and laminate.

The Science Behind Self-Leveling Properties

The unique properties of self-leveling concrete are based on scientific principles and precise formulations. The mix’s viscosity and flow characteristics enable it to spread uniformly without manual intervention. Polymers significantly enhance performance by boosting adhesion to substrates and promoting flexibility. Furthermore, the distribution and particle size of aggregates critically impact fluidity, ensuring effective filling of voids without trapping air.

Step-by-Step Application of Self-Leveling Concrete

Achieving optimal results from self-leveling concrete hinges on proper application. Follow this detailed guide for a successful installation:

  1. Preparation of the Substrate: Start with a clean surface, addressing any damages.
  2. Mixing the Self-Leveling Compound: Adhere closely to the manufacturer’s mixing instructions.
  3. Pouring the Concrete: Begin pouring in small sections, starting from one corner.
  4. Spreading and Leveling: Utilize a long-handled squeegee to evenly distribute the mixture.
  5. Curing and Drying: Allow the concrete to cure as recommended to gain strength.
  6. Final Floor Finishing Options: Select your preferred floor covering once the mixture is fully cured.
  7. Inspection of the Surface: Review for imperfections, addressing any issues promptly.
  8. Troubleshooting Common Issues: Tackle problems like air pockets while the mixture remains workable.
  9. Maintaining the Finished Surface: Implement care routines to extend the longevity of the surface.
  10. Safety Precautions During Application: Always wear appropriate safety gear and ensure proper ventilation.

Common Challenges and Solutions When Using Self-Leveling Concrete

Despite its many benefits, challenges can arise during the application of self-leveling concrete. Here are some common issues and their solutions:

  1. Inadequate Surface Preparation: Thorough cleaning and repairs are crucial before application.
  2. Improper Mixing Ratios: Strictly follow the manufacturer’s mixing guidelines.
  3. Environmental Conditions: Monitor temperature and humidity to ensure proper application.
  4. Delayed Curing Time: Allow for full curing as specified to achieve optimal results.
  5. Bonding Issues: Properly prime the substrate to prevent bonding failures.
  6. Cracking or Shrinkage: Consider using fiber reinforcement for added security.
  7. Surface Imperfections: Address any issues promptly while the mix remains workable.
  8. Equipment Malfunctions: Ensure all tools are suitable and in good condition.
  9. Misestimating Coverage Area: Carefully calculate square footage before purchasing materials.
  10. Contamination of the Mix: Maintain a clean work environment to control contamination during mixing.
